About this map

The North Canadian River carves a deep valley through the high plains of western Oklahoma, defining the character of this mid-century landscape. Small agricultural settlements like Oakwood and Eagle City serve as anchors for the surrounding rural sections, which are densely dotted with family and community landmarks. The concentration of religious and memorial sites, such as the Church of the First Born, Rising Sun Ch, and the Mt Hope Cem, reveals the deeply rooted social fabric of Dewey and Blaine counties.
